Patient Care Manager
Location: Ottawa, ON
Alta Vista Animal Hospital is welcoming a Patient Care Manager to join our team (General Practice & Emergency). This position reports directly to the Client Care Manager. This position is open to Client Care Representatives, Veterinary Technicians and Assistants.
**Schedule:**This is a full-time (35-40 hours weekly) permanent position. The shifts will include days, evenings and weekends.
Patient Care Responsibilities:
This position is responsible for several aspects of in-hospital patient care, including coding files, serving as the liaison between the DVM and the client for patient, medical, and financial updates, performing patient discharges, handling payments, and educating the client on home care and necessary follow-up instructions.
This position is also responsible for client patient follow-up calls, assisting with dietary recommendations & other aspects of client care.
Qualifications:
- Required: Fluent in English (Reading, Writing and Oral); and, Able to support patients up to 50kg and lift up to 25kg.
- Preferred: Fluently bilingual in French and English (Reading, Writing and Oral). 1 year of client care experience.

About VCA Canada
VCA Canada Animal Hospitals is a family of over 140 small animal veterinary practices located across 6 Canadian provinces. Our team of over 4,000 associates provide our communities with general, emergency and specialty services in our practices, offering compassionate care for pets and their families.
